Vermont Brown Swiss Claims Grand Champion at 2014 Premier National Junior Show

Maple Sugar Martha, the 5 Year Old class winner and Senior Champion exhibited by Chelsea Young, Tinmouth, Vt., was named Brown Swiss Grand Champion at the Premier National Junior Show during the All-American Dairy Show on Monday, Sept. 15 at the Pennsylvania Farm Show and Complex in Harrisburg.

Reserve Grand Champion was awarded to Intermediate Champion WSC Wonderment Christy, shown by Madison Weaver, Ephrata, Lancaster County. Reserve Intermediate Champion was awarded to Buckeye Knoll Driver Emy exhibited by Sarah Rhoades of Greenville, Ohio.

Young’s Forest Lawn Gateway Vine placed first in the 6 Year Old & Older class and was Reserve Senior Champion.

The Junior Champion heifer, Cutting Edge T Delilah, was exhibited by Mikayla Fulper, of Ancramdale, N.Y. Emily Mikel from Ancramdale, N.Y., exhibited the Reserve Junior Champion, Cutting Edge T Dixie.

The judge was Patrick Conroy of Angola, In.

First place animals, owners and hometowns:
Spring Calf – Cutting Edge T Dixie, Kyle Barton, Ancramdale,NY
Winter Calf – Buckeye Knoll Mojo Vegas, Hannah Rhoades, Greenville, Ohio
Fall Calf – Just In Agenda Past ET, Brooke Cornell, Berlin, Somerset Co.
Summer Yearling – Four Seasons Po Jelly, David Schultheis, Butler Co.
Spring Yearling – Turnpike View Got The Look, Jade Zimmerman, Stevens, Lancaster Co.
Winter Yearling – Cutting Edge T Delilah, Kyle Barton, Ancramdale, N.Y.
Fall Yearling – Mases Manor Granslam Lola, Jon Beiler, Fredericksburg, Lebanon Co.
Dry Cow – Milk & Honey Bonanza Katrina, Gianna Novak, Flemington, N.J.
Jr. 2 Year Old – Turnpike View Totally Gorgeous, Jaralyn Zimmerman, Stevens, Lancaster Co.
Sr. 2 Year Old – WSC Wonderment Christy, Madison Weaver, Ephrata, Lancaster Co.
Jr. 3 Year Old – Old Mill Goliath Fancy, Abby Sterner, Barto, Berks Co.
Sr. 3 Year Old – Buckeye Knoll Driver Envy, Sarah Rhoades, Greenville, Ohio
4 Year Old – Mort Blessing Tressel Faith, Grace Spadaro, Scottdale, Westmoreland Co.
5 Year Old – Maple Sugar Martha, Chelsea Young, Tinmouth, Vt.
6 Years Old & Older – Forest Lawn Gateway Vine, Chelsea Young, Tinmouth, Vt.
Best Female Bred & Owned – WSC Wonderment Christy, Madison Weaver, Ephrata, Lancaster Co.

The 2014 All-American Dairy Show runs Sept. 12-18 at the Pennsylvania Farm Show Complex and Expo Center in Harrisburg. This year’s show features 22 shows in six days, the nation’s only all-dairy antiques show, nearly 3,000 animals and 1,500 exhibitors from across the nation.
